Data Collection Elements
Observation method
This method is used concurrently with quantitative methods but, it is said to be comparatively entailing. As a method of gathering information, it gathers more information and has a validating aspect that these other methods lack. By observation method, - a researcher - is in a position to resolve differences that may be present of be appearing in a study. Observation also allows researcher gather information that would otherwise be unavailable. In the case of the dance_of_ the call_bells, the observed disconnect as far as the call bells goes is not obtainable with required objectivity other than through observation.
Observations made clearly brought to light the notion that matters concerning the call bells were an everyday occurrence. The observation method of data collection also highlighted the frequency of call bells, the numbers, who responded and the times that the bell was rung. This provides essentially important quantitative data that would be used to fortify the observations made.

Interviews
Interviews measure and gather opinions from subjects in a study Desimone & Kerstin Carlson Le, 2004.
In this study, the interviews were used to gather information on the call bells as well as complement the information gathered through observations.
Elements of analysis
Analysis conducted covered all the data collection aspect simultaneously using them to compare and complement. The simultaneous use of the different kinds of information assists in collaborating and validating results. The analysis statistically left no room for error by using all the available avenues and information in coming up with conclusions. The confirmation of avoidance behavior observed was confirmed by the patients interviews and the photographic images around the call bell console. The analysis methodology used validated information and allowed for assertiveness in drawing a conclusion.
Elements Used in Measurement
The measures used in the survey included assessing the size of the nursing area, proximity of the area to the call bell console, the frequency of bell rings the particular bell rang, the source of the bell ringing, the time take to respond to the singing bell and, the time take to attend to patients needs and finally the attending persons to the call.
